Breaking News: Shooting in PA Leaves 3 Dead, Suspect in Police Custody in Trenton

On Saturday, March 16th, residents of Falls Township, PA, and surrounding areas, woke up to a shelter-in-place alert after an armed assailant, identified as Andre Gordon, shot and killed two people in Levittown, across the New Jersey-Pennsylvania border.

The shooting, which occurred around 8:50 am, was followed by Gordon, 26, shooting and killing another person a few blocks after the first incident before fleeing the scene.

Gordon reportedly hijacked a car at gunpoint. The victim of the car hijacking was reportedly uninjured. A few hours later, the stolen vehicle was found abandoned in Trenton, New Jersey.

The Trenton Police Department, in collaboration with the Falls Township Police Department, Pennsylvania and New Jersey State Police, and the FBI, announced that around 1:15 pm, SWAT teams had located and set up a parameter around a house in Trenton where it is believed that Gordon had barricaded himself with hostages.

The SWAT team successfully evacuated the hostages, leading to a multi-hour standoff that ended at 5:15 when the Mayor of Trenton confirmed that Gordon was in police custody.

This story is developing.
